大家好,今天小编关注到一个比较有意思的话题,就是关于c语言数组做参数的问题,于是小编就整理了1个相关介绍c语言数组做参数的解答,让我们一起看看吧。
mysql的存储过程怎么传入数组参数?
没试过往里面传数组,都是多传几个参数,把几个参数放入SqlParameter[]中,然后cmd.Parameters.AddRange(pars); 创建方法: SqlParameter[] paras = new SqlParameter[] { new SqlParameter("@PageIndex","ccc"), new SqlParameter("@PageSize","ccc"), new SqlParameter("@StrSql","ccc") }; ccc就是你想传入的值,带@的就是你在存储过程中定义的参数。 算是一种另类的数组吧。要不你就把所有条件组合成一个字符串,中间用特殊符号隔开,到数据库用split方法再分回来,不过这个方法比较麻烦,不推荐
到此,以上就是小编对于c语言数组做参数的问题就介绍到这了,希望介绍关于c语言数组做参数的1点解答对大家有用。
标签: 数组 参数 SqlParameter